Career positions & opportunitiesHealthcare Assistant | Assist healthcare professionals in providing care to patients in hospitals, clinics, or residential settings. |
---|---|
Support Worker | Provide support and assistance to individuals with physical or mental disabilities in their daily activities. |
Care Coordinator | Coordinate care services for individuals in need, ensuring they receive appropriate support and resources. |
Social Worker | Work with individuals and families to address social and emotional issues, providing support and guidance. |
Nurse Practitioner | Provide advanced nursing care to patients, including diagnosing illnesses, prescribing medications, and managing treatment plans. |
Healthcare Manager | Oversee the operations of healthcare facilities, ensuring quality care delivery, staff management, and regulatory compliance. |

The QCF Health and Social Care Qualification is designed to provide individuals with the necessary skills and knowledge to work effectively in the health and social care sector. The qualification levels range from Level 2 to Level 6, catering to individuals at different stages of their career. At Level 2, learners will develop a basic understanding of health and social care practices, while Level 6 focuses on advanced skills and leadership in the field. The learning outcomes include communication skills, understanding of health and social care policies, and promoting person-centered care. The duration of the qualification varies depending on the level, with Level 2 typically taking around 6-12 months to complete, and Level 6 requiring several years of study and work experience. The industry relevance of the qualification is high, as it equips individuals with the necessary skills to work in a variety of health and social care settings, such as hospitals, nursing homes, and community care organizations.
